Yongping Sun is a scholar working on Applied Mathematics, Numerical Analysis and Modeling and Simulation. According to data from OpenAlex, Yongping Sun has authored 31 papers receiving a total of 388 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Applied Mathematics, 18 papers in Numerical Analysis and 6 papers in Modeling and Simulation. Recurrent topics in Yongping Sun's work include Nonlinear Differential Equations Analysis (28 papers), Differential Equations and Boundary Problems (20 papers) and Differential Equations and Numerical Methods (18 papers). Yongping Sun is often cited by papers focused on Nonlinear Differential Equations Analysis (28 papers), Differential Equations and Boundary Problems (20 papers) and Differential Equations and Numerical Methods (18 papers). Yongping Sun collaborates with scholars based in China, Australia and Singapore. Yongping Sun's co-authors include Min Zhao, Lishan Liu, Xiao–Ping Zhang, Xiaoping Zhang, Lokenath Debnath, Lei Gao, Enyu Wang, Xinye Zhang, Senquan Liu and Ding Ma and has published in prestigious journals such as SHILAP Revista de lepidopterología, Advanced Science and Journal of Mathematical Analysis and Applications.
